Testing Children w/ Autism Using Visual Supports
Wednesday, March 24, 2010 - 2:30 pm
  » Length: 2 hours 
  » Location: Little Friends Center for Autism
  » Location Details: 140 N. Wright Street
                              Naperville, IL 60540
                              Map-it with Google Maps
download event info
Presenter will discuss strategies for performing an accurate and thorough assessment of children with the autism spectrum. Proper selection of tests, strategies for structuring the testing session (including the use of visual systems in the context of assessment) and methods of modifying tasks to gain a greater understanding of the test taker’s strengths, weakness and learning styles will be discussed. Strategies for addressing difficult behaviors which can serve as obstacles to testing will also be addressed.
